Electric, Ice, Poison, Rock, and Steel moves hit Enamorus for super-effective damage. The upside? Ground and Dragon-type moves can't touch it at all. The Fairy/Flying typing picks up 4 resistances to work with.
| Damage | Types |
|---|---|
| 2x (Weak) | Electric, Ice, Poison, Rock, Steel |
| 0.5x (Resist) | Grass, Dark |
| 0.25x (Resist) | Fighting, Bug |
| 0x (Immune) | Ground, Dragon |

At 580 BST, Enamorus is built different. We rank it B-Tier. As a Legendary Pokemon, the raw stats back up the reputation. Best used as a sweeper.
Enamorus gets Contrary and Cute Charm. But Contrary is the one that matters. It's the centerpiece of every viable set. Build around that. With base 106 Speed, Contrary gives Enamorus an edge before opponents can react.
Enamorus is a mixed attacker with base 115 Attack and 135 Sp. Atk. Enough bulk to take a hit or two, too. Speed tells the real story. Base 106 Speed lets it outrun most of the field. Fits the sweeper role.
Enamorus's hidden ability is Contrary. Inverts stat changes. Better than the standard options for competitive play.
